When RADIUS authentication is used, the RADIUS server stores the user accounts -
usernames, passwords, and access levels (authorization). When a management user
(client) tries to access the device, the device sends the RADIUS server the user's
username and password for authentication. The RADIUS server replies with an acceptance
or a rejection notification. During the RADIUS authentication process, the device's Web
interface is blocked until an acceptance response is received from the RADIUS server.
Communication between the device and the RADIUS server is done using a shared secret,
which is not transmitted over the network.

15.3.6.1 Setting Up a Third-Party RADIUS Server

The following procedure provides an example for setting up a third-party RADIUS sever,
FreeRADIUS which can be downloaded from www.freeradius.org. Follow the instructions
on this Web site for installing and configuring the server. If you use a RADIUS server from
a different vendor, refer to its appropriate documentation.
To set up a third-party RADIUS server (e.g., FreeRADIUS):
1.
Define the device as an authorized client of the RADIUS server, with the following:
Predefined shared secret (password used to secure communication between the
device and the RADIUS server)
Vendor ID (configured on the device in ''Configuring the RADIUS Vendor ID'' on
page 244)
